See why so many travellers make Candy Cane Inn their hotel of choice when visiting Anaheim. Providing an ideal mix of value, comfort and convenience, it offers a family-friendly setting with an array of amenities designed for travellers like you.

Guest rooms offer a flat screen TV, air conditioning, and a refrigerator, and Candy Cane Hotel makes getting online easy as free wifi is available.

In addition, guests can enjoy a pool and free breakfast during their visit. As an added convenience, there is free parking available to guests.

Close to some of Anaheim's most popular landmarks, such as Christ Cathedral (2.3 km) and Angel Stadium of Anaheim (3.0 km), Candy Cane Hotel is a great destination for tourists.

If you’re looking for a seafood restaurant, consider a visit to Roy's Restaurant, Bubba Gump Shrimp Co., or Catch, which are all conveniently located a short distance from Candy Cane Inn.

There is no shortage of things to do in the area: explore popular history museums such as Founder's Park.

I've stayed at the Candy Cane Inn in the Fall of 2010 and 2011 and have plans to return again at somepoint this year as well. The hotel is literally only a few minutes walk to Disneyland and California Adventure, and it is on the same side of the street. Garden Walk is on the other side of the street, just a few blocks down. Walking is easy and convenient; however, if you get tired they have a frequent shuttle. There is a convenience store at the corner that is open 24-hours for coffee, etc. However, Candy Cane Inn does a wonderful job at serving a continental breakfast in the morning. You have your choice of cereal, yogurt, danish, fruit, juices and coffee/tea. The pool is small, but there is a hot tub and everything is well maintained and clean. The grounds are absolutely georgous. There are many, many plants, flowers, and foliage everywhere! The rooms are very well decorated and clean and roomy enough for 3-4 people to get around. Also, it is a maker-or-breaker for me with first impressions, which include the front desk staff. From the first time I've ever contacted them, everyone -- and I mean EVERY ONE of them -- have gone above-and-beyond to make my stay great! I really enjoy staying at this hotel... it is my hotel of choice for when I go to Disneyland! Vakay

Candy Cane Inn is a GREAT place to stay. The staff is very friendly and helpful. My family had the opportunity to stay in both the standard and premium rooms. While the premium room has extra perks and larger rooms, the standards are great too! The rooms were super quiet. Both rooms were by the stairs and I was worried it would be loud with all of the foot traffic. Aside from the occassional excited child we hardly heard any noise. We spent only a small amount of time in the rooms as we were in Disneyland ALL day. We did have a chance to take advantage of the pools, and the kids pool is really great. It was nice to be able to relax in the sun while my son played in the shallow pool! The grounds are beautiful and extremely well maintained.
The only advice I have, because I don't want to call it a complaint since it wasn't a big deal to us, is to get to breakfast early. If you have a premium room be sure to order breakfast delivery. It is worth it. When we were in the standard room we got breakfast and brought it to our room. It gets a bit crowded in the dining area. The breakfast is very low key but great as we had been eating all kinds of "fair" type food in Disneyland.
The walk to Disneyland is great. If you are in relatively good health it will be a breeze. From the exit gate at Disney to the hotel is 12 minutes at a normal walk. We had amazing weather so we didn't mind walking. The shuttle was prompt and clean. We mostly used it to get to the park as we had a difficult time keeping ourselves on schedule for pickup!
We will absolutely stay here again!

My family (3 of us,) have been making our annual trip to disneyland for 9 years. The last 4 years and 6 visits we have stayed at the Candy Cane Inn, for eight days. I put together many disneyland trips for friends and always put them up at the Candy Cane Inn. First of all it's beautiful, and quaint with it's European style, and you can tell it's family owned and run. Location is amazing! You can walk, but the shuttle is convenient and the drivers are so nice, they always recognize us each year. They are very accommodating, I always ask for a 2nd floor so I don't have a direct view of the parking lot, and for a longer stay the deluxe room is just a bit bigger. The pool is small but nice, and never feels crowded, and the complimentary breakfast, is really the "cherry on top". It saves money and time, and my husband brings it back to the room for me while I'm getting ready and they sit down at the pool. The only negative thing about the hotel is arriving at the front desk. Although accommodating, it's not friendly, not warmly welcoming. I know they probably have no idea how many times I have stayed or how many people I have sent there, but that shouldn't really matter, everyone should be received warmly and welcoming. Even some of the people I have sent there mentioned the same feeling. Which is too bad, because this hotel is really a little gem! And perfect for your visit to disneyland.

My family has stayed at the Candy Cane Inn 4 times in the year of 2011 and each time has been fantastic. There is nothing i could have to complain about. The breakfast is great and free with items such as variety of bagels, toast, yogurt, donuts, muffins, coffee, and juice. The shuttle is always there on time and is very convienent to get to the park. There are two stores right next to the candy cane, 7-eleven and ABC market. It's very convienent because my family will always go there in the morning and get water bottles and snacks so that we dont have to spend even more money at disney. It saves you quite a few bucks considering a water bottle at disney is $4. The beds are comfortable and the tv's have all the standard channels. Candy Cane even has roll away beds if you have 5 people staying in the room. My brother always gets it and he says it is very comfortable. Whenever me and my family go to Disneyland we never even consider going anywhere else but the Candy Cane. We love it! I was just there a couple of days ago and I cant wait to go back! The Candy Cane Inn is a 5 out of 5. I highly reccomend staying there.
